Jill Kintner (R) of the U.S. rides past Tanya Bailey (C) of Australia and Nicole Callisto (L) of Australia during the women's semifinal run for the BMX cycling competition at the Beijing 2008 Olympic Games, August 22, 2008.

It's not hard to see why BMX racing was made an Olympic sport for the first time this year, and it's not just because it appeals to young people. It features furious, non-stop action, soaring jumps and chain reaction crashes. No lane markers in this race.
